Ben Grimes

Assistant Professor of Legal Writing

William B. “Ben” Grimes joined the Alabama Law faculty in 2026 as an Assistant Professor of Legal Writing. Before joining the faculty, Professor Grimes practiced commercial and appellate litigation at a national law firm in Birmingham, focusing on business, antitrust, and accreditation disputes. Before entering private practice, Professor Grimes clerked for Chief Judge L. Scott Coogler of the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Alabama. 

Professor Grimes graduated summa cum laude and Order of the Coif from the University of Alabama School of Law, where he was the Acquisitions Editor of the Alabama Law Review, a member of the Moot Court Board, a recipient of the M. Leigh Harrison Award, and a Hugo L. Black Scholar. He holds an undergraduate degree in Biology (summa cum laude) from the University of Alabama. He is Of Counsel to Maynard Nexsen PC and is a member of the Alabama State Bar.
